Surendranagar, Gujarat — The Aam Aadmi Party Gujarat unit has announced a major “Kisan Mahapanchayat” to address multiple farmer-related concerns, including the installation of power transmission lines in agricultural fields without farmers’ consent. The announcement was made through the party’s official X (formerly Twitter) handle.
The upcoming Kisan Mahapanchayat is scheduled to be held on 27 June 2026 (Saturday) near Bapa Sitaram Madhuli, Village Nagara, Vadhvan, Surendranagar district. The event is expected to bring together farmers from various villages to raise their grievances and demand policy-level action.
Focus on farmer issues through Kisan Mahapanchayat
According to the announcement, the Kisan Mahapanchayat will primarily highlight concerns related to land use, compensation, and infrastructure development affecting agricultural fields. One of the key issues raised is the alleged installation of electricity transmission lines in farmland without proper consent or adequate compensation to farmers.
Party leaders stated that the Kisan Mahapanchayat will serve as a platform for farmers to directly present their problems and seek accountability from the administration. The gathering aims to strengthen farmer voices and push for immediate resolution of long-standing issues.
